VB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2018 in Review

831 of the 4,368 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ard Small-Cap ETF (VB) for Q2 2018, worth a combined $12.3B — up 7.2% from $11.4B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 61 funds opened new VB positions and 29 closed out — a net gain of 32 holders — while 357 added to existing stakes and 267 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Cornerstone Wealth Management, adding an estimated $216M. The largest seller was Goldman Sachs, cutting an estimated $163M.
